Understanding Fee Structures: Transparency is Key
Legal fees can vary significantly based on the lawyer's experience, the complexity of the case, and the practice area. Common fee structures include hourly rates, flat fees, and contingency fees (often used in personal injury cases, where the lawyer is paid a percentage of the settlement or award). It is vital to have a clear, written agreement detailing all costs, retainers, and how expenses will be handled.
Don't shy away from discussing fees upfront. The best lawyers in Florida are transparent about their billing practices. Ensure you understand what is included in the fee and what might incur additional charges. This clarity prevents misunderstandings and ensures you are comfortable with the financial commitment involved in pursuing your legal objectives.

FAQ: Your Questions Answered About Florida Lawyers
What is the typical hourly rate for a lawyer in Florida?
The hourly rates for lawyers in Florida can vary widely, depending on their experience, specialization, geographic location within the state, and the complexity of the case. Generally, you might expect rates to range from $200 per hour for a less experienced attorney or for simpler matters, to $750 per hour or more for highly specialized attorneys or those with a significant track record of success in complex litigation. It is always best to confirm the specific hourly rate directly with the attorney during your initial consultation.
